Output 64431abfe5861d60f6ad8f5a7bcd5c67127640b171341b7a5b4314e4e0cf4fe3:1

value
617090
script pubkey
OP_0 OP_PUSHBYTES_20 cd58d408f29038c3c3d766ab806e062ed2aeb1fb
address
ltc1qe4vdgz8jjquv8s7hv64cqmsx9mf2av0mzxwskc
transaction
64431abfe5861d60f6ad8f5a7bcd5c67127640b171341b7a5b4314e4e0cf4fe3
spent
true